I might not have been very clear. We weren't able to find a small dog at any of the shelters we visited. We got Kermit as a result of a "Small Dog Wanted" ad my wife placed on Craig's List. He was free. The lady even threw in toys, food, a dog crate, flea & tick drops, a choke chain collar (now I know why), and more. She insisted on no money, but we forced her to take $50 - telling her to spend it on her grandkids.

The woman has had a really hard year. Her husband of 22 years died in April after a long illness. Her daughter is divorcing and has moved in with mom, along with her two toddlers. Kermit belonged to her son who moved to an apartment that does not allow pets and left mom with the burden of taking care of a pet she didn't want. She can't deal with everything that's happening and says the dog deserves an owner who will give him some attention. I agree and we SHOULD be exactly what he needs.

She said her son obtained the dog from a shelter when he was 7 months old. She says he will turn 2 on July 4th. That may or may not be true. Kermit is extremely fat for a 24 month old dog that eats Purina Pedigree dry dog food. (However, he is a ridiculously sedentary dog, so maybe it's possible.) I think he could stand to lose ten pounds (from 35 to 25.)

He's neutered and seems healthy. Since he's from a shelter, he's probably been chipped - not that it would have mattered to us had he not returned from the forest. The hypothetical chip isn't registered to us, but to the previous owner.

Kermit has grey on his muzzle. My old Australian Shepherd started developing grey hair when he was 5 or 6, I think.

We're taking Kermit to a vet on Friday. We'll ask for his/her opinion on the dog's age. He or she can probably give us an estimate by looking at the teeth. Dog's usually develop plaque after a few years unless they've been brushing regularly... which I somehow doubt Kermit has.
